Urea-formol adhesives are largely used in the wood products industries. Construction materials are the main source of formaldehyde emissions in the indoor environment.
Therefore, it is necessary to find new natural alternatives to produce wood adhesives.
This project allowed developing and validating extraction process for tannins, based on aqueous extraction, and lignin. These extracted compounds were successfully inserted in adhesives to develop a formula without formaldehyde. The mechanical properties of the panel board produced with this new adhesive responded to European standard.
